Hosea 13:7

So I am to them like a lion; like a leopard I will lurk beside the way.

Jeremiah 5:6

Therefore a lion from the forest shall strike them down; a wolf from the desert shall devastate them. A leopard is watching their cities; everyone who goes out of them shall be torn in pieces, because their transgressions are many, their apostasies are great.

Hosea 5:14

For I will be like a lion to Ephraim, and like a young lion to the house of Judah. I, even I, will tear and go away; I will carry off, and no one shall rescue.

Lamentations 3:10

He is a bear lying in wait for me, a lion in hiding;

Isaiah 42:13

The LORD goes out like a mighty man, like a man of war he stirs up his zeal; he cries out, he shouts aloud, he shows himself mighty against his foes.

Amos 1:2

And he said: "The LORD roars from Zion and utters his voice from Jerusalem; the pastures of the shepherds mourn, and the top of Carmel withers."

Amos 3:4

Does a lion roar in the forest, when he has no prey? Does a young lion cry out from his den, if he has taken nothing?

Amos 3:8

The lion has roared; who will not fear? The Lord GOD has spoken; who can but prophesy?"
